Inflationary Trends: The Fight against Rising Prices

One of the key factors determining the current economic picture is inflation. In a number of large economies, including the United States and the Eurozone countries, there is an increase in inflationary pressures. Rising prices for energy, raw materials and transport pose challenges for central banks, which face a dilemma between maintaining economic growth and fighting rising inflation.

Trade Disputes and Global Tariffs: New Realities of World Trade

Trade disputes continue to be at the forefront, affecting global economic indicators. Recent tariff changes between the US and China, as well as other major trading partners, are creating uncertainty for global businesses. It is expected that the resolution of these disputes will be an important step for the stabilization of world trade.

Technological Innovation: The Engine Of Economic Growth

Technological innovations continue to play a crucial role in shaping global economic indicators. The development of artificial intelligence, blockchain technologies and digitalization of industry contributes to productivity growth and the creation of new market opportunities. However, with this growth come new challenges, including cybersecurity issues and ethical aspects of the use of technology.
